Meaning and Origin
Cache is a unisex name with English, American, and French roots. It is derived from the English word "cache," which means "a hiding place or storage place." Its French origin, "cacher," meaning "to hide or conceal," adds another layer of depth and meaning to the name. The name's origins in various languages contribute to its unique and slightly enigmatic quality, making it both familiar and mysterious. While the meaning of "hiding place" might not be the first thing that comes to mind when considering a baby name, it does add a certain mystique to Cache.
Pronunciation and Spelling
Cache is a relatively straightforward name to pronounce, with a crisp, clean sound. It is pronounced "kash," with the emphasis on the first syllable. While it's a simple word, it has a modern and somewhat unconventional feel that could appeal to some parents. However, it's crucial to note that some people might initially pronounce it as "cash," due to the common association with money. This potential for mispronunciation should be considered when choosing a name, especially as your child grows older and might have to constantly correct people.
